How they compare

Georgia currently reports 330.08 million against 259.46 million in Barbados, a difference of 70.62 million.

That makes Georgia's figure about 1.3 times Barbados's.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 81 shared years of data; in 1945 it was Georgia ahead.

Barbados ranks 24th and Georgia ranks 21st of 196 countries.

Across the 9 decades both report, Barbados averaged higher in 2 and Georgia in 4.

Head to head by decade

Decade Barbados Georgia Difference Ahead
1940s 0 0 0 β€”
1950s 0 0 0 β€”
1960s 0 0 0 β€”
1970s 1.95 million 0 1.95 million Barbados
1980s 20.72 million 0 20.72 million Barbados
1990s 14.25 million 39.91 million 25.66 million Georgia
2000s 0 65.52 million 65.52 million Georgia
2010s 14.00 million 248.31 million 234.31 million Georgia
2020s 314.27 million 422.89 million 108.62 million Georgia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
